Introduction to Flexible P1.25 LED Display Technology for Billboards

The advertising landscape is undergoing a radical transformation, moving beyond static vinyl and rigid panels toward dynamic, high-resolution digital solutions. Among the most advanced offerings in this space is the flexible P1.25 LED display, a technology that combines ultra-fine pixel pitch with physical adaptability. Designed specifically for premium billboard installations, this display technology delivers a pixel pitch of 1.25 millimeters, which translates to a resolution of 640,000 pixels per square meter. This density ensures that content appears exceptionally sharp, even at close viewing distances, making it ideal for high-traffic urban environments where viewers are often within three to five meters of the screen. The flexibility of the module, typically achieved through a proprietary soft PCB and durable silicone or composite material, allows the display to conform to curved surfaces, columns, and irregular architectural forms. This capability opens up creative possibilities that rigid displays cannot match, enabling advertisers to wrap entire building facades or create seamless concave and convex billboard structures without visible gaps or distortion.

Technical Specifications and Performance Parameters

Understanding the technical backbone of a flexible P1.25 LED billboard is essential for evaluating its suitability for demanding commercial applications. The pixel pitch of 1.25 mm is the defining characteristic, allowing for a native resolution that supports full HD (1920 x 1080) content on a screen size of just 2.4 meters by 1.35 meters. Brightness levels for these displays typically range from 1500 to 2500 nits, calibrated to combat ambient light in shaded or semi-outdoor environments. For full outdoor exposure, brightness can be boosted to 5000 nits or higher using specialized high-brightness LEDs, though this may impact power consumption. The refresh rate is a critical factor for video playback, with most professional-grade flexible P1.25 panels operating at 3840 Hz or higher. This high refresh rate eliminates flicker in camera recordings and ensures smooth motion reproduction for fast-paced advertising content. Power draw is another key consideration; a typical flexible P1.25 module consumes approximately 800 to 1000 watts per square meter at maximum brightness, though this can be reduced to 200 to 300 watts per square meter in standby or dimmed states. The ingress protection rating for indoor or protected outdoor use is generally IP40 on the front and IP20 on the rear, while weatherproof versions achieve IP65 on the front and IP54 on the rear, allowing operation in dusty or humid conditions without compromising the flexible substrate.

Design Flexibility and Structural Integration for Billboards

The primary advantage of a flexible P1.25 LED display lies in its ability to bend and contour without damaging the circuitry or affecting image quality. These modules are engineered with a minimum bending radius of approximately 500 to 800 millimeters, depending on the manufacturer, which allows them to wrap around cylindrical pillars, curved walls, and even spherical structures. This flexibility is achieved through a combination of flexible printed circuit boards and segmented LED packages that maintain consistent spacing during deformation. For billboard applications, this means that a single continuous image can span multiple curved surfaces, creating an immersive viewing experience that captures attention from multiple angles. The lightweight nature of these panels, often weighing less than 10 kilograms per square meter, reduces the structural load on existing building frameworks and simplifies installation. Magnetic mounting systems and quick-lock mechanisms are standard, enabling rapid assembly and disassembly for maintenance or content updates. The seamless tiling capability, with cabinet tolerances of less than 0.1 millimeters, ensures that there are no visible seams or brightness mismatches between adjacent modules, even on complex curved installations.

Image Quality and Viewing Experience

Image fidelity is paramount for billboard advertising, where brand perception hinges on visual clarity and color accuracy. The flexible P1.25 LED display excels in this regard, offering a contrast ratio of 5000:1 or higher, which produces deep blacks and vibrant colors even in high-ambient-light conditions. The use of surface-mount device (SMD) LEDs, typically in a 3-in-1 package (red, green, and blue in a single chip), ensures uniform color mixing and wide viewing angles of 160 degrees horizontally and vertically. This wide angle is critical for billboards placed in busy intersections or along highways, where viewers approach from various directions. The recommended viewing distance for a P1.25 display ranges from 1.5 to 10 meters, making it suitable for both close-up pedestrian viewing and distant vehicular observation. Color temperature can be adjusted from 3200K to 9300K, and the display supports a color depth of 16 bits or higher, allowing for smooth gradients and realistic skin tones. Advanced calibration algorithms, including per-pixel brightness and color correction, ensure uniformity across the entire billboard surface, eliminating the "dirty screen" effect common with lower-quality LED panels.

Installation, Maintenance, and Durability Considerations

Installing a flexible P1.25 LED billboard requires careful planning and specialized expertise due to the unique mechanical properties of the panels. The modular design typically allows for front or rear access, with front access being more common for wall-mounted curved installations. Each module connects via a standard RJ45 or Ethernet cable for data transmission and a power cable, with daisy-chaining capabilities reducing wiring complexity. The operating temperature range for these displays is generally -20 degrees Celsius to 60 degrees Celsius, with humidity tolerance of 10 percent to 90 percent non-condensing. For outdoor applications, additional cooling systems such as fans or heat sinks are integrated into the cabinet design to prevent overheating. Maintenance is simplified by the hot-swappable nature of the modules; a single faulty panel can be removed and replaced without powering down the entire billboard. The expected lifespan of the LEDs is typically 100,000 hours to half-brightness, ensuring years of reliable operation with minimal degradation. Regular cleaning of the display surface with a soft brush or compressed air is recommended to maintain optimal brightness and prevent dust accumulation on the flexible surface.

Applications and Future Trends in Flexible LED Billboards

The flexible P1.25 LED display is already transforming high-end advertising environments, from luxury retail storefronts and airport terminals to corporate lobbies and entertainment venues. Its ability to create seamless curves and unique shapes makes it a favorite for architectural integration, where the display becomes part of the building design rather than an add-on. In retail, these displays are used for dynamic window displays that wrap around corners, drawing foot traffic from multiple directions. The trend toward higher pixel densities continues, with manufacturers already developing P0.9 and P0.7 flexible panels for even closer viewing distances. However, the P1.25 pitch remains the sweet spot for billboard applications, balancing resolution with cost and power efficiency. Future developments include improvements in flexible substrate materials that allow for tighter bending radii without signal degradation, as well as advancements in microLED technology that could further reduce pixel pitch and increase brightness. As 5G networks enable real-time content streaming and interactive advertising, the flexible P1.25 LED display will play a central role in creating immersive, data-driven experiences that respond to audience behavior and environmental conditions. Smart LED Displays and IoT Integration

The convergence of LED display technology and IoT (Internet of Things) is creating a new category of smart displays. These connected screens can automatically adjust brightness based on ambient light, display real-time content from cloud platforms, and collect audience analytics through built-in sensors. This intelligence makes LED displays more energy-efficient and effective for advertising and information delivery.

Transparent LED Displays Transform Architecture

Transparent LED displays are gaining popularity in commercial architecture, offering up to 85% transparency while displaying vivid content. These innovative screens are being installed in shopping mall facades, airport terminals, and luxury retail stores, allowing natural light to pass through while delivering digital content. The technology eliminates the need to choose between windows and screens.

LED Display Sustainability Initiatives

Leading LED display manufacturers are embracing sustainability with eco-friendly manufacturing processes, recyclable materials, and energy-efficient designs. New generation LED displays consume up to 40% less power than models from five years ago. Additionally, the long lifespan of LED technology (100,000+ hours) significantly reduces electronic waste compared to alternative display solutions.
